Subject: [PATCH v2 3/3] ARM: dts: Use new media bus type macros
Date: Sun, 6 Mar 2022 19:39:05 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220306173905.22990-4-laurent.pinchart@ideasonboard.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220306173905.22990-1-laurent.pinchart@ideasonboard.com>
Now that a header exists with macros for the media interface bus-type
values, replace hardcoding numerical constants with the corresponding
macros in the DT sources.
Signed-off-by: Laurent Pinchart <laurent.pinchart@ideasonboard.com>
---
arch/arm/boot/dts/imx6ul-14x14-evk.dtsi | 4 +++-
arch/arm/boot/dts/omap3-n900.dts | 5 +++--
arch/arm/boot/dts/r8a7742-iwg21d-q7-dbcm-ca.dts | 11 +++++++----
.../dts/r8a7742-iwg21d-q7-dbcm-ov5640-single.dtsi | 4 +++-
.../dts/r8a7742-iwg21d-q7-dbcm-ov7725-single.dtsi | 4 +++-
arch/arm/boot/dts/stm32429i-eval.dts | 3 ++-
arch/arm/boot/dts/stm32mp157c-ev1.dts | 3 ++-
7 files changed, 23 insertions(+), 11 deletions(-)
diff --git a/arch/arm/boot/dts/imx6ul-14x14-evk.dtsi b/arch/arm/boot/dts/imx6ul-14x14-evk.dtsi
index a3fde3316c73..89234bbd02f4 100644
--- a/arch/arm/boot/dts/imx6ul-14x14-evk.dtsi
+++ b/arch/arm/boot/dts/imx6ul-14x14-evk.dtsi
@@ -2,6 +2,8 @@
//
// Copyright (C) 2015 Freescale Semiconductor, Inc.
+#include <dt-bindings/media/video-interfaces.h>
+
/ {
chosen {
stdout-path = &uart1;
@@ -170,7 +172,7 @@ &csi {
port {
parallel_from_ov5640: endpoint {
remote-endpoint = <&ov5640_to_parallel>;
- bus-type = <5>; /* Parallel bus */
+ bus-type = <MEDIA_BUS_TYPE_BT601>;
};
};
};
